Name origin and meaning
The name Pryor derives from an occupational or status-based descriptor rooted in Middle English vocabulary. It signifies a person who held the ecclesiastical title of Prior, referring to the head of a religious house. Therefore, its intrinsic meaning relates directly to leadership and seniority within a community structure. This authoritative background is key to understanding its development. The transition from a title to a fixed surname, and eventually a given name, reflects this distinguished history.
